二进制如何计算
二进制计算是基于2的幂次方进行的,每个位置上的数字只能是0或1,在计算机中,所有的数据都是以二进制形式存储和处理的。
十进制的数字5,其二进制表示为101,这是因为1乘以2的2次方(十进制的2)等于4,加上0乘以2的1次方(十进制的0)等于0,再加上1乘以2的0次方(十进制的1)等于1,所以结果是101。
在二进制计算中,我们常用的基本运算有加法、减法、乘法和除法,这些运算在二进制下都可以转换成一系列简单的操作。
二进制的加法可以转换为对应的位操作:如果两个数的某一位都是0,那么结果的这一位就是0;如果其中一个数的这一位是1,另一个数的这一位是0,那么结果的这一位就是1;否则,结果的这一位就是这两个数的这一位的和。
同样,二进制的减法、乘法和除法则需要通过一系列的条件判断和移位操作来实现。
需要注意的是,二进制计算虽然简单,但是对于非程序员来说理解起来可能会有些困难,在实际的编程工作中,我们通常会使用各种编程语言提供的内置函数或者库来进行二进制相关的计算。